The core business of a life coach is to direct an individual to achieve one or more objective in life.This entails giving mental , moral support and even material support to the client.
.
The word LIFE I have used on my clients.

L in LIFE

This is the first stage you Listen to your client and Learn the problems that are blocking  his or her  development. Take notes at this stage and sketch the development path that you and your client need to walk through to achieve the objectives.

I in Life

This ‘ i ‘ in life stands for ‘EYE’. The coach must be able to see beyond the client’s problem by internalizing the feelings, fear and hope of the client.

F in life

This is a critical stage of life coaching and where the F words and four letter words are used and your expectations both as a client may be at crossroads and frustration is the order of the day. This where we need to sit down and FORMULATE a life plan. I call it the survival stage where both coach and client must do a realty check and come up with a workable life plan.

The plan should have deliverables and timetable  which both parties must commit themselves religiously. The plan should also be resourced either in the form of fees or other form of payment.

E in Life

The E in life stands for engagement. We must engage with our client on all levels. The coach must be involved in the business and social life in order for him to develop strategies that are relevant to the development of his or her client. The coach can seek the assistance of workmates, family members and others within the client’s social circle.

The E in life stands for the end. Coaching as I have already say is game or simulation. It must come to an end where we evaluate our successes and failures both as a client and coach. We must look at the agreed deliverables and see if  we have met our objectives.

The evaluation stage can also be used to see the effectiveness of the  coach ,his or her coaching programme or regime.

Here are the five solutions to growth and they are not in order.

Increase your customer base

I know when we talk of growth in retail we visualize chains of supermarkets and lots of customers passing through the point of sales, now if I have one bottle store with ten crates and say 200 cigarettes it would be crazy to open a second branch as I will not have enough capital and stock.

The short term solution will be to increase our customer base. Customer bases are hard to increase but this can be increased by making your business visible through improved customer relationship management. There is nothing that beat good old advertising, sales promotions and word of mouth as ways to increase your customer base. Customers can win and be reached through the social media channels such as Facebook It is a must that the customer base be increased, Twitter, Google and other emerging social media firms on the internet.

The increase of the customer base will result in an increase in turnover and this will spur the growth of the business and create a basis for further solutions.

Sell more products

Once you have increased your customer base and turnover, the next step is to increase the lines of products you sell. This will result in a further increase in both turnover and the customer base.

Develop new products and services

This is the climax of the growth solution as you will now be able to introduce new goods and services because you will by now have the muscle and capital to your established customer base. In my case, I might put a pool table or Wi-Fi in the bottle store. This process is the most important as the business owner must read both the market and competition as he or she introduces the new product and services.

Increase the price of your goods and services

At this point the business owner the especially if he is the only one at a location like our perennial rural store can afford to increase the price of his product to grow his business as he has no other option, except the last solution below.

Open a new branch

I have now come to a point where I now have adequate management skills and in some case, skilled and experienced staff. The secret of opening a second branch is to set it up using existing stocks and staff. This will ensure a smooth take off. This is the last step in the growth process and we can start the cycle to get to the next level and open the third branch.
